North Esports Appoints Graham Pitt as Head of Esport Operations

North Esports has appointed Graham Pitt as the Head of its Esport Operations. He was the Tournament Director at ESL before he joined RFRSH Entertainment as Director of Esport operations.
North also says farewell to Jonas Svendsen, who is pursuing a business position in EPIC Games, the company behind Fortnite.
“Thanks is a tiny word to the great people I have had the chance to meet and work within Esports, and I am so grateful that I got to experience the competitive side of gaming once again,” Jonas Svendsen said.
“We want to thank Jonas for his hard work and passion for North, and we wish him the best of luck in one of the most successful companies in the gaming sphere,” North CEO Christopher Håkonsson said.
“We’re looking to establish a permanent sporting team consisting of Graham Pitt and a dedicated professional from the absolute elite, who will be an integral part of the player’s daily routine. As we go forward, North should compete among the top teams in all esport titles that we compete in,” Christopher Håkonsson added.
